I would never recommend mailing in your ECU for a generic reflash unless you just need something simple like removing the speed limiter or raising the rev limiter.. but you can see good results with etuning-- you get your own cable to reflash and going back and forth with a tuner adjusting the tune with datalogs that you record while driving around. Still cheaper than a dyno tune and you get the cable so you can reflash back to stock and sell it used later on, reflash updates if you need any, as well do all kinds of OBD2 diagnostics like checking and clearing codes
